New Calibre Companion release V3.2.4 replaced with V3.2.5

Today I released CC V3.2.4. Unfortunately it had a problem talking to older versions of calibre, I replaced it with V3.2.5.

If you were very quick you might have downloaded the flawed CC release. If you did and if you are using calibre 1.11 or older, then in some situations wireless connections will hang. Simply update to V3.2.5 to fix the problem.
